From part (b), the sum of the ages of the 6 students currently in the Art Club is
96.
If n 15-year old students join the club, the
number of students in the club will be 6+n, and the sum of their ages will be
96+15n.
When n 15-year old students join the club, the
mean age of all students in the club is 15.5.
Solving for n, we get 6+n96+15n96+15n96+15n3=15.5=15.5(6+n)=93+15.5n=0.5n and so n=0.53=6. Therefore, the number
of 15-year old students that must
join the Art Club so that the mean age of the students in the club is
15.5 is 6.
